Role at the CIA and Advisory Functions
- ποΈ Caine details his role as Associate Director for Military Affairs (ADMA) at the CIA, an office established by Congress to provide best military advice to the CIA Director.
- π€ This role involved globally integrating CIA and DoD activities, similar to the Chairman's responsibilities, and required collaboration with the State Department, interagency partners, and allies and partners.
- π‘ Caine emphasizes that his nomination is for an advisory job, not a command position, drawing parallels to his previous role.
Interaction with the State Department
- π Caine's substantive interaction with the State Department began as a White House Fellow working on a global pandemic plan, fostering an appreciation for the diplomatic element of power.
- π£οΈ He acknowledges the potential for frustration with silos between different government branches (State, Intel, DoD) but sees value in diverse perspectives to avoid groupthink.
Signature Achievement with Allies
- βοΈ Caine identifies the 2003 Scud hunt as his signature achievement, where he worked closely with UK and Australian allies in a coalition effort.
- β He has sustained these relationships and maintains deep connections with closest allies, expressing a commitment to continuing this collaboration if confirmed.
- πΊοΈ His past relationships and promotion of the AUKUS framework are viewed as positive attributes.
